Javier Pérez de Cuéllar, born on January nineteenth, nineteen twenty, was a distinguished Peruvian diplomat and politician. He is best known for his tenure as the fifth secretary-general of the United Nations, a role he held from nineteen eighty-two to nineteen ninety-one. His leadership during this pivotal period coincided with the final decade of the Cold War, where he played a crucial role in various international conflicts and negotiations.

During his time at the United Nations, Pérez de Cuéllar was actively involved in addressing significant global issues, including the Iran–Iraq War, the Western Sahara conflict, and the Cyprus problem. He also contributed to the discussions surrounding Namibian independence under the Tripartite Accord, the Soviet withdrawal from Afghanistan, and the Gulf War, showcasing his diplomatic prowess on the world stage.

In addition to his UN service, Pérez de Cuéllar served as the prime minister of Peru from two thousand to two thousand one. His political career was marked by a commitment to peace and diplomacy, and he was a member of the Club of Madrid, which comprises former heads of state and government, as well as the Inter-American Dialogue.
